Area Sales Manager Jobs in Virginia: Frequently Asked Questions
How do you become a area sales manager in Virginia?
Most area sales manager roles in Virginia require a bachelor's degree in business, marketing, or a related field, though no state-issued license is required for the position itself. Virginia employers typically promote from within, so starting as a sales representative or account executive with a Virginia-based company and building a strong territory record is the most direct path. Industry-specific certifications, such as those in technology solutions or healthcare sales, meaningfully strengthen a candidacy in Virginia's dominant sectors.
How much do area sales managers make in Virginia?
Area sales managers in Virginia earn a median of about $191,130 a year, based on May 2025 Bureau of Labor Statistics wage data, ranging from around $94,710 for the lowest 10% to over $302,900 for the top 10%. Pay rises with experience, specialty, and employer.

Are there remote area sales manager jobs in Virginia?
Yes, but they're relatively limited, since area sales managers are typically expected to maintain in-person relationships within a defined Virginia territory. About 25% of area sales manager openings tied to Virginia are remote or hybrid as of September 2026, reflecting that the role requires regular field presence. The functions most amenable to remote work are pipeline reporting, virtual client check-ins, and internal team coaching, while prospecting and account visits remain on-site.
How can I get hired as a area sales manager in Virginia with little or no experience?
The most realistic entry path is starting as a sales development representative or account executive at a Virginia-based technology, healthcare, or federal contracting firm and building measurable territory results over two to three years. Large Virginia employers such as Leidos and Cardinal Health run structured sales associate and rotational programs that develop candidates into management roles. Completing a recognized sales certification and demonstrating CRM proficiency gives candidates without direct management experience a concrete edge in Virginia's competitive market.
